At old age, the hydrogen fuel in the Sun’s core gets exhausted, and the gravitational pull exceeds the thermal pressure. As a result, the star is pulled inward, and the temperature in the core is increased.
When the temperature reaches a certain point, helium and carbon begin to fuse up at the center of the core. The star is now in the form of concentric shells and, hydrogen-helium fusion takes place in the shells.
The Sun attains a giant size, and its color turns to red. The continuing fusion of carbon and helium results in the accumulation of carbon ash in the Sun’s core. The Sun becomes deficient of fuel as the fusion process continues. As the Sun is about to collapse, plasma and gas are ejected, forming nebula. After millions of years, the nebula leaves behind the Sun as a carbon core called a white dwarf.
